Pair Trading with Blackrock Enhanced and Blackrock International
The main advantage of trading using opposite Blackrock Enhanced and Blackrock International positions is that it hedges away some unsystematic risk. Because of two separate transactions, even if Blackrock Enhanced position performs unexpectedly, Blackrock International can make up some of the losses. Pair trading also minimizes risk from directional movements in the market.
